  • Patent number: 6512384
    Abstract: Minority carrier diffusion lengths are determined fast, accurately, and conveniently by illuminating a surface of the semiconductor with a beam composed of a plurality of light fluxes each having a different wavelength modulated at a different frequency. Surface photovoltages induced by different light fluxes are simultaneously detected by monitoring surface photovoltage signals at the different modulation frequencies. The surface photovoltage signals are frequency calibrated and then used to calculated a minority carrier diffusion length.
